Reno 2026 Mayoral Race is Slowly But Surely Shaping Up

The latest available contributions and expenses report for Reno councilman Devon Reese now has a line and amended CE Report listing that it is for the office of City of Reno Mayor.

The contributions already listed for late 2024 include $2,500 from the Heinz Ranch Land Company, $3,000 from Herbert Simon, $5,000 from Frank Suryan, $2,500 from the McDonald Carano Government Affairs group, $1,000 from Sunny Hill Ranchos and $1,000 from the Nevada Republic Alliance.

Expenses include $1,000 for William Puchert, $1,000 for the Albee Ariel Foundation and $990 for a trip to Brooklyn for a Make the Road Action.

If joining the mayoral 2026 Reno race, the councilman will be up against former Democratic Lieutenant Governor Kate Marshall.

A video and social media from yesterday indicated businessman and regular also ran candidate Eddie Lorton, who lost to Reese in a previous at large council race, also plans to run to replace the termed out Mayor Hillary Schieve.
